To properly evaluate your coin it needs to be out of the holder, properly oriented and photographed in natural lighting.

Correction- Is this coin in a Paramount Redfield holder? If so, do not remove it from the holder! It is worth more money in the Redfield holder!

Full pictures of the coin in the holder is a must for a better evaluation.
